Lines Matching refs:ndev
1051 isdn_net_xmit(struct net_device *ndev, struct sk_buff *skb) in isdn_net_xmit() argument
1055 isdn_net_local *lp = netdev_priv(ndev); in isdn_net_xmit()
1058 if (((isdn_net_local *) netdev_priv(ndev))->master) { in isdn_net_xmit()
1067 return isdn_ppp_xmit(skb, ndev); in isdn_net_xmit()
1070 nd = ((isdn_net_local *) netdev_priv(ndev))->netdev; in isdn_net_xmit()
1073 printk(KERN_WARNING "%s: all channels busy - requeuing!\n", ndev->name); in isdn_net_xmit()
1132 static void isdn_net_tx_timeout(struct net_device *ndev) in isdn_net_tx_timeout() argument
1134 isdn_net_local *lp = netdev_priv(ndev); in isdn_net_tx_timeout()
1136 printk(KERN_WARNING "isdn_tx_timeout dev %s dialstate %d\n", ndev->name, lp->dialstate); in isdn_net_tx_timeout()
1156 ndev->trans_start = jiffies; in isdn_net_tx_timeout()
1157 netif_wake_queue(ndev); in isdn_net_tx_timeout()
1166 isdn_net_start_xmit(struct sk_buff *skb, struct net_device *ndev) in isdn_net_start_xmit() argument
1168 isdn_net_local *lp = netdev_priv(ndev); in isdn_net_start_xmit()
1186 netif_stop_queue(ndev); in isdn_net_start_xmit()
1195 isdn_net_adjust_hdr(skb, ndev); in isdn_net_start_xmit()
1205 isdn_net_unreachable(ndev, skb, "dial rejected: interface not in dialmode `auto'"); in isdn_net_start_xmit()
1218 isdn_net_unreachable(ndev, skb, "dial rejected: retry-time not reached"); in isdn_net_start_xmit()
1245 isdn_net_unreachable(ndev, skb, in isdn_net_start_xmit()
1270 isdn_net_unreachable(ndev, skb, "dial rejected: packet filtered"); in isdn_net_start_xmit()
1277 netif_stop_queue(ndev); in isdn_net_start_xmit()
1287 isdn_net_unreachable(ndev, skb, in isdn_net_start_xmit()
1294 ndev->trans_start = jiffies; in isdn_net_start_xmit()
1298 ret = (isdn_net_xmit(ndev, skb)); in isdn_net_start_xmit()
1299 if (ret) netif_stop_queue(ndev); in isdn_net_start_xmit()
1302 netif_stop_queue(ndev); in isdn_net_start_xmit()
1785 isdn_net_receive(struct net_device *ndev, struct sk_buff *skb) in isdn_net_receive() argument
1787 isdn_net_local *lp = netdev_priv(ndev); in isdn_net_receive()
1800 ndev = lp->master; in isdn_net_receive()
1801 lp = netdev_priv(ndev); in isdn_net_receive()
1805 skb->dev = ndev; in isdn_net_receive()
1816 skb->protocol = isdn_net_type_trans(skb, ndev); in isdn_net_receive()
1984 isdn_net_init(struct net_device *ndev) in isdn_net_init() argument
1999 ndev->hard_header_len = ETH_HLEN + max_hlhdr_len; in isdn_net_init()